As such, analysts must be careful to compare two companies over … See more WebJun 1, 2024 · The regular filing deadline is the 15th day of the 4th month following the end of the estate's income tax year. For an estate income tax year ending on December 31, the regular filing deadline is April 15 of the following year. If done by the regular deadline, an automatic 5½ month extension can be requested.

WebThe first fiscal quarter in a fiscal year starts on the first day of that fiscal year, and the last fiscal quarter ends on the last day of that fiscal year. Each fiscal quarter cannot be longer than 119 days and, except for the first and last quarters of the fiscal year, each fiscal quarter cannot be shorter than 84 days.
